Output 308887a7f54a61ffa3d63c29c6ec524e8c41c5ce2d80e6299ba7c2132983334d:1

value
16980238
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 302deb506cdea39cf0aa024c60377d55faab5628 OP_EQUALVERIFY OP_CHECKSIG
address
LPchhwcxiEprugPzGn3RihsLouaJwTUXGU
transaction
308887a7f54a61ffa3d63c29c6ec524e8c41c5ce2d80e6299ba7c2132983334d
spent
true